UV Blue Information

Ingredients of Uv Blue

Zinc Oxide
Avobenzone
Oxybenzone

General precautions for Uv Blue

  1. Use lukewarm water or normal water for rinsing your skin.
  2. Take a shower before using Uv Blue.
  3. Use Uv Blue as per the prescription of your doctor. Do not overuse it.
  4. Avoid referigerating Uv Blue. Keep it in a cool and dry place.
  5. If you observe an allergic reaction to Uv Blue, consult your doctor immediately.
  6. A pregnant woman should consult a doctor before taking Uv Blue.
  7. It is recommended that a doctor be consulted before Uv Blue is used by nursing mothers.
